Facility Evaluation Report
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Salia Walker arrived at the facility unannounced to conduct a required Annual visit. This annual had a specific emphasis on infection control practices and procedures. The LPA met with Staff upon arrival, and explained the reason for the visit.
At 9:25 a.m., the LPA conducted a record review that confirmed Staff #1 (S1) is not associated to the facility. Staff #2 (S2) confirmed that S1 has been working at the facility for two (2) days without association to the facility. The LPA advised S2 that all staff are to obtain a California clearance or a criminal record exemption as required by the Department prior to working at a licensed facility. On 7/29/2021, the Department issued a citation and assessed civil penalties under section 87355(e)(1) for staff non-association. Therefore, the facility is being issued a repeat violation, and civil penalties are being assessed for S1 not having a criminal record clearance prior to working at the facility. S2 acknowledged and stated they will be covering for the rest of the day, until another staff that is associated is able to relieve.
The LPA toured the physical plant areas inside and outside, with S2 at 9:32 a.m., to ensure there are no health and safety hazards.
BEDROOMS: The LPA observed the resident bedrooms which were furnished with clean linens, appropriate furnishings, and sufficient lighting. At 9:27 a.m., the LPA observed two (2) boxes of cigarettes in room #2. Staff immediately stored the cigarettes in a secured closet. On 7/30/2021, the Department issued a citation for section 87705(f)(2). Therefore, civil penalties are being assessed today for a repeat violation, as the licensee failed to ensure the cigarettes were stored inaccessible to residents with dementia.
